Winter delivered a 1-2 combination this weekend, with ridiculous cold giving way to a howling storm last night. At times it was difficult to see more than a few feet in front of you.....and to tell if it was really snowing as hard as it looked, or simply blowing itself around in an attempt to look more badass. It was the kind of storm you could hear.....pounding against the windows and walls trying to get in. It was the kind of storm that made you grateful for shelter. And fearful for those who don't have it. A pleasant diversion for some....sitting in front of a fire as they look out the front windows. For others, a terrifying night of unknowns. Which shelters are open? Which ones have room? When will the winds finally die down?
